Misted panes

Double glazing windows are a great form of insulation for your home. Double glazing windows are made up of two panes of glass with a space in between. They offer thermal insulation and noise reduction. If the window seal is damaged or damaged, moisture could be introduced into the space, causing the windows to mist up. This can be a gruelling issue however it's not unusual and is easily fixed.

Condensation between glass panes is a frequent issue when using double-glazed windows. This is caused by a number of issues, including broken or damaged windowpane seals, wear and tear on seals, or even poor installation. In some cases this could result in having to replace windows since the seals aren't capable of doing their job of keeping dampness and water out of the home.

If a double-glazed window has been misted there are a couple of steps that can be taken to correct the issue. Make use of a dehumidifier with a plug-in as an option. This will help reduce airborne moisture and prevent the problem from recurring. Another option is to clean the windows with non-abrasive cleaning solutions. These products can be bought at most hardware stores and can help get rid of the condensation.

These products can be helpful however it is crucial to speak with an expert to determine the root of the issue. A specialist can clean the window frames, examine for mould or mildew growth and carry out the process of resealing. This will ensure that moisture is kept out of the home and also prevent condensation from forming in the future.

Maintaining your windows will help avoid misted glass. It is recommended that you clean the exterior with a window replacement near me cleaning solution and also use a dehumidifier in your home. This will keep the humidity low and stop moisture from causing issues with the double glazing.

Make sure that curtains and blinds are away from windows, as they can cause condensation on the surface. If a problem does arise it is essential to consult with an expert as this could be a difficult job and may require replacement of the entire window.

Broken seals

The seals between the glass panes of double or triple windows are crucial to keep inert gases such as argon and krypton in place. However, these seals will be damaged over time and may require repair or replaced. A regular maintenance program can help prevent this issue from happening. Every two years, window seals must be re-caulked and wooden frames should be painted or stained regularly. These measures can make windows last longer and prevent the necessity for replacements or repairs of the glass units that are insulated (IGUs).

There are a few signs that your window repairs near me seal is not working properly. A hazy appearance is the most obvious, however you might also notice an increase in your energy bills or find that your windows are becoming cloudy. Both of these are indications that argon or Krypton gas is escaping from your windows and that their insulation function is reducing.

Replacement-Windows-150x150.jpgA broken window seal could be a serious issue however, it can be fixed with expert assistance. This isn't a project that you can tackle by yourself, as it requires removing the window and cleaning the IGUs and then refilling them with appropriate inert gas. You will also need be careful to ensure that the new IGU has been properly installed and is free of any contaminants such as grease from your hands or the tools.

Some people ignore a broken window seal, if it doesn't cause significant increase in their energy bills or fogging. This is a mistake since the window seal will continue to degrade as time passes and will eventually stop functioning.

A professional glazier can repair your triple or double glazing if the window seals are damaged. If the frame of your windows are severely damaged, you will need to replace the whole window. In these instances it is generally recommended to invest in an insulated window that is more efficient than your single pane windows. These windows are typically less expensive when purchased during sales or promotions.
